The Hidden Costs of Manual Workflows in Commercial Real Estate

The Hidden Costs of Manual Workflows in Commercial Real Estate

Outdated, manual processes are silently draining time, money, and opportunity from commercial real estate (CRE) firms. What seems like routine administration can compound into significant operational risk and lost revenue.

Lease tracking remains one of the most labor-intensive and error-prone tasks in CRE. Teams often rely on spreadsheets and fragmented documents, increasing the likelihood of missed rent escalations, renewal deadlines, or compliance obligations.

  • Manually abstracting lease terms can take hours per document
  • Critical clauses may be overlooked due to human error
  • Data inconsistencies arise when transferring details across systems
  • Lack of centralized visibility delays strategic decisions
  • Missed compliance windows expose firms to legal and financial penalties

According to Kolena's industry analysis, legacy platforms like Yardi and RealPage store data but fail to extract actionable insights efficiently—creating a costly gap between information and action.

Tenant communication is another area where manual workflows backfire. Responding to inquiries via email, phone, or portals without automation leads to delayed response times and inconsistent messaging—hurting tenant satisfaction and retention.

Consider this: a mid-sized CRE firm managing 50+ properties reported spending over 30 hours weekly handling routine tenant requests. Without automated routing or compliance-aware responses, staff struggled to maintain service levels, especially during lease renewals.

Meanwhile, 46% of CRE finance leaders cite cutting operational costs as a top priority, according to U.S. Bank research. Yet, many continue investing in piecemeal tools that don’t integrate or scale.

Worse still, compliance risks grow as regulations like GDPR and SOX demand tighter data controls. Manual handling increases exposure to breaches, with third-party cyberattacks disrupting CRE operations for 2–3 weeks on average, per U.S. Bank findings.

These hidden inefficiencies don’t just slow teams down—they create avoidable financial and reputational liabilities.

Why Off-the-Shelf AI Tools Fall Short for CRE Firms

Why Off-the-Shelf AI Tools Fall Short for CRE Firms

Commercial real estate (CRE) firms are turning to AI to cut costs and streamline operations—but many are discovering that off-the-shelf automation platforms can’t keep up with their complex, compliance-heavy workflows. While no-code and subscription-based tools promise quick wins, they often deliver brittle integrations, limited customization, and long-term dependency.

According to U.S. Bank research, 46% of CRE finance leaders prioritize efficiency gains through technology. Yet, generic AI tools fail to address core industry challenges like lease abstraction, tenant communication compliance, and real-time market analysis.

These platforms typically offer:

  • Superficial API connections that break under data complexity
  • Inflexible workflows unable to adapt to changing regulations
  • No ownership of data or logic, creating vendor lock-in
  • Minimal support for legacy systems like Yardi or RealPage
  • Poor handling of multimodal data (e.g., leases, emails, financials)

For example, tools like LeaseLens and Docsumo use AI to extract lease data faster than manual entry, but they operate in silos. They don’t integrate contextually with a firm’s CRM or accounting software, requiring redundant oversight. As noted in Kolena’s analysis, even advanced document processors fall short without deep system alignment.

Moreover, compliance risks remain high. With regulations like GDPR and SOX in play, automated tenant responses must be auditable and secure. Off-the-shelf chatbots often lack compliance-aware logic, increasing legal exposure. Third-party cyberattacks in CRE already cause 2–3 weeks of downtime on average, per U.S. Bank insights.

A real-world gap emerges when firms try to scale. While 51% of real estate executives plan AI investments to digitize operations (Agora Real), subscription tools hit limits as portfolios grow. They can’t evolve with business needs—unlike custom systems built for long-term adaptability.

Consider a mid-sized CRE firm using a no-code platform to manage tenant inquiries. Initially, it reduces response time. But when lease terms change or new privacy laws take effect, the system can’t auto-update. Staff must manually adjust triggers, defeating the purpose of automation.
